The Abu Dhabi Police Criminal Investigation Department team ranked first place in the Government Department Sports Association Championship for the Seven-a-side Football Competition, season 2012/2013.

The championship, organized by the Government Sports Association, was held yesterday at the Sultan Bin Zayed Al Nahyan Stadium in Abu Dhabi. The Port Fouad team ranked as the first runner-up among 12 participating teams.

The Abu Dhabi Police Criminal Investigation Department team was able to win the match by beating its opponent, the Port Fouad team with a score of 2-0 in an interesting match characterized by strong players. Defensive strikes were exchanged between the two teams, where the offensive player, Adel Haboush of the Criminal Investigation Department team, scored two clean goals.

The final ceremony was attended by Colonel Dr. Rashed Bu Rashid, Director of the Criminal Investigation Department, and Colonel Ibrahim Sultan Al Zaabi, Deputy Director of the Criminal Investigation Department, along with a number of officers and heads of departments and branches in the Criminal Investigation Department of Abu Dhabi Police.

On the occasion of the team’s achievement, Lt. Colonel Faisal Ali Al Kaabi, the leader of the Criminal Investigation football team, expressed his sincere congratulations to Major General Mohammed bin Al Awadhi Al Menhali, Director General of Police Operations at the Abu Dhabi Police, and Colonel Dr. Rashed Bu Rashid wishing all the winners further sporting achievements.

Lt. Colonel Al Kaabi expressed his sincere thanks to the organizers for their great efforts throughout the 18-day event (May 22nd to June 10th). Concluding, he expressed his thanks to the institutions and the teams that took part in the championship.
